
Yamazaki is Japan's first and oldest malt whisky distillery, established in 1923 by Shinjiro Torii, the founder of Suntory. Located at the foot of Mt. Tennozan, southwest of Kyoto, the distillery was built in a region historically prized for its pure water and misty climate — conditions long considered ideal for crafting fine spirits. Torii, originally a pharmaceutical wholesaler who made his name selling Akadama sweet red wine, set out to create a uniquely Japanese whisky that would stand alongside the great Scotch traditions. What sets Yamazaki apart is its philosophy of producing a wide multiplicity of styles within a single distillery. By using varied still shapes, fermentation vessels, and cask types, Yamazaki crafts whiskies of remarkable diversity. The core portfolio centers around four celebrated single malts: the Distiller's Reserve, and the 12, 18, and 25-year-old expressions. These releases are known for their elegance, complexity, and a delicate balance of fruit, spice, and oak that is distinctly Japanese in character. Over the decades, Yamazaki has grown from a pioneering local experiment into a globally revered icon. The distillery continued to expand Suntory's whisky range through the 1940s and 1950s, and today Yamazaki single malts are widely regarded as benchmarks of Japanese whisky craftsmanship, attracting both collectors and investors around the world.
